Putting together a remote access network really can be this quick

Having a secure remote access network in place can help you decrease downtime, and save travel costs and time. Most important right now is the safety factor: Some companies have travel restrictions in place to help protect employees and their families during the pandemic.

Connecting and monitoring dispersed sites may be easier than you think. For a webinar, we recently created an always-on remote access network across three locations: Boston, Dubai, and Brisbane. Yep, we set up remote data transfers among three continents in a few minutes.
